Spaces:
Running
Running
admin
commited on
Commit
·
21e99f3
1
Parent(s):
a9ee06f
refine init
Browse files
app.py
CHANGED
@@ -34,7 +34,7 @@ def extract_fst_url(text):
|
|
34 |
|
35 |
|
36 |
def infer(video_url):
|
37 |
-
video
|
38 |
if not video_url:
|
39 |
desc = "The video sharing link is empty!"
|
40 |
return video, parse_time, desc, avatar, author, sign
|
@@ -53,6 +53,7 @@ def infer(video_url):
|
|
53 |
video_id = response_data["play_url"].split("video_id=")[1].split("&")[0]
|
54 |
video = download_file(response_data["video_url"], video_id)
|
55 |
parse_time = response_data["parse_time"]
|
|
|
56 |
additional_data = response_data["additional_data"][0]
|
57 |
desc = additional_data["desc"]
|
58 |
avatar = additional_data["url"].split("?from=")[0]
|
@@ -79,14 +80,10 @@ if __name__ == "__main__":
|
|
79 |
),
|
80 |
],
|
81 |
outputs=[
|
82 |
-
gr.Video(
|
83 |
-
label="Video download",
|
84 |
-
show_download_button=True,
|
85 |
-
show_share_button=False,
|
86 |
-
),
|
87 |
gr.Textbox(label="Parsing time", show_copy_button=True),
|
88 |
gr.Textbox(label="Video description", show_copy_button=True),
|
89 |
-
gr.Image(label="Author avatar"
|
90 |
gr.Textbox(label="Author nickname", show_copy_button=True),
|
91 |
gr.TextArea(label="Author signature", show_copy_button=True),
|
92 |
],
|
|
|
34 |
|
35 |
|
36 |
def infer(video_url):
|
37 |
+
video = parse_time = desc = avatar = author = sign = None
|
38 |
if not video_url:
|
39 |
desc = "The video sharing link is empty!"
|
40 |
return video, parse_time, desc, avatar, author, sign
|
|
|
53 |
video_id = response_data["play_url"].split("video_id=")[1].split("&")[0]
|
54 |
video = download_file(response_data["video_url"], video_id)
|
55 |
parse_time = response_data["parse_time"]
|
56 |
+
|
57 |
additional_data = response_data["additional_data"][0]
|
58 |
desc = additional_data["desc"]
|
59 |
avatar = additional_data["url"].split("?from=")[0]
|
|
|
80 |
),
|
81 |
],
|
82 |
outputs=[
|
83 |
+
gr.Video(label="Video download", show_download_button=True),
|
|
|
|
|
|
|
|
|
84 |
gr.Textbox(label="Parsing time", show_copy_button=True),
|
85 |
gr.Textbox(label="Video description", show_copy_button=True),
|
86 |
+
gr.Image(label="Author avatar"),
|
87 |
gr.Textbox(label="Author nickname", show_copy_button=True),
|
88 |
gr.TextArea(label="Author signature", show_copy_button=True),
|
89 |
],
|